hold on the 7th instant, is reproduced in full, from the short-hand notes of our morning, contemporary, in last Saturday's Government Gesetle. It has evidently been carifully edited, and headings have been | interspersed thronghout its entire length so ne to make more plains the drift of the showy statement. The labour of the Press reporter, however, is conveniently left un acknowledged.
